Question: Merveille Investments has completed their 2020 financial year which ran from the 1 September 2019. The company sells sanitisers and made a high quantity of sales, N$ 421 000, a 75% increase in sales from the prior year. The company manufactures sanitizers with the use of machinery valued at N$ 300 000, the machinery is carried at FV and the FV at the end of the 2019 year was N$300 000. All operations take place from a factory with a right of use asset of N$ 2 000 000. The asset is amortised over ten years and was initially recognised at the beginning of the prior financial year. The corresponding lease liability for the year is 1900000 it was 1500000 at 31 August 2019.

The company was founded in 2018 with share capital of 4 000 000. It was a good investment since the company made profits of 50 000 in the prior and profit for the year increased by 300%. The company does not have a dividend policy, since it has never declared dividends.

Required: 1. Compare the company's performance against the prior year performance

Hint: Use Du Pont Analysis

2. Suggest why the company performance may have changed from one year to the next.

3. Advice the board on how to improve the equity multiplier.

4. How will the items recognised in terms of IFRS 16 be presented in the annual financial statements. Also discuss the how the tax relating to said items will be disclosed.
